Collision & Repair Technology Schools in Mississippi

76 students earned Autobody/Collision and Repair Technology/Technician degrees in Mississippi in the 2021-2022 year.

As a degree choice, Collision & Repair Technology is the 37th most popular major in the state.

Racial Distribution

The racial distribution of autobody/collision and repair technology/technician majors in Mississippi is as follows:

  • Asian: 0.0%
  • Black or African American: 69.7%
  • Hispanic or Latino: 1.3%
  • White: 22.4%
  • Non-Resident Alien: 0.0%
  • Other Races: 6.6%

Jobs for Collision & Repair Technology Grads in Mississippi

In this state, there are 2,240 people employed in jobs related to an autobody/collision and repair technology/technician degree, compared to 232,610 nationwide.

undefined

Wages for Collision & Repair Technology Jobs in Mississippi

A typical salary for a autobody/collision and repair technology/technician grad in the state is $41,520, compared to a typical salary of $46,460 nationwide.
